arXiv:2608.01662v2 Announce Type: replace-cross Abstract: DeepSeek Sparse Attention (DSA) enables efficient long-context modeling through its Lightning Indexer. However, practical deployment remains constrained by the indexer's expensive $O(L^2)$ scoring overhead and the hardware-inefficient, discontinuous memory-access patterns induced by its outputs. To address these system-level bottlenecks, we introduce LongCat Sparse Attention (LSA), a hardware-algorithm co-designed framework comprising three complementary and orthogonal strategies: (1) Streaming-Aware Indexing, which selectively converts scattered KV entries into hardware-aligned contiguous layouts to enable coalesced HBM access; (2) Cross-Layer Indexing, which amortizes indexing overhead by reusing the results produced by a single layer across consecutive layers, supported by cross-layer distillation;
